Congratulations to Bianca Fontanin from the 04/05 ECNLR Girls team who signed to play for Ave Maria University in Florida.

Congratulations to SCU player Bree Ehmer who signed to play for Catawba College in Salisbury, NC on National Signing Day. Bree plays for Coach Mike Lord and Kevin Smith on the 04/05 ECNLR Girls Team.

Space Coast United’s All-Star program provides a next-level soccer experience for Recreational players ages 6 to 9. The focus of the program is the development of individual skills and to prepare the players for their progression to more competitive play at the U-9 level. Nick Spielman, a Space Coast United alum who now plays for Chattanooga FC of the National Independent Soccer Association, was recently named to the NISA’s All-League First Team for his stellar play as a defender. Six former Space Coast United players were a part of the Eastern Florida State College women’s soccer team that won the National Junior College Athletics Associations (NJCAA) National Championship in November.
